AI Chatbot Improves Farming in Cyclone-Ravaged Malawi
In Malawi, an AI-powered chatbot called Ulangizi is helping small-scale farmers like Alex Maere recover from Cyclone Freddy and drought by providing farming advice, resulting in increased income and improved food security.

German Media's Neglect of the Global South
A study reveals that German-language media outlets dedicate only around 10% of their coverage to the Global South, despite it housing 85% of the world's population, highlighting a systemic bias that fuels misinformation and hinders effective solutions to global issues.

Western Sydney Housing Crisis Deepens as Developers Exit
Property developers are abandoning large-scale residential projects in Western Sydney due to high costs and slow price growth, exacerbating the housing crisis; developers are moving to more profitable areas like Rose Bay and Northbridge.

Cornwall Housing Plan Threatens Ancient Site
A proposed 70-home development near Truro's ancient Plain-an-gwarry amphitheatre sparks local concern over the impact on the village's cultural heritage and infrastructure; developers insist the plan will enhance the site's visibility and accessibility.
